CAS 105919-28-6

:

2-fluoro-CyClopropanamine

Description:
2-Fluoro-cyclopropanamine is a chemical compound characterized by its cyclopropane ring structure, which is a three-membered carbon ring, and the presence of an amino group (-NH2) and a fluorine atom attached to the second carbon of the ring. This compound is classified as an amine due to the presence of the amino group, which can participate in hydrogen bonding, influencing its solubility and reactivity. The fluorine atom introduces unique electronic properties, potentially enhancing the compound's reactivity and stability compared to its non-fluorinated counterparts. 2-Fluoro-cyclopropanamine may exhibit interesting pharmacological properties, making it of interest in medicinal chemistry and drug development. Its small size and the presence of functional groups suggest potential applications in various chemical reactions, including nucleophilic substitutions and as a building block in organic synthesis. Formula:C3H6FN
InChI:InChI=1/C3H6FN/c4-2-1-3(2)5/h2-3H,1,5H2
SMILES:C1C(C1N)F
Synonyms:
  • Cyclopropanamine, 2-fluoro-, (1R,2S)-rel-
  • rel-(1R,2S)-2-Fluorocyclopropanamine
  • Cis-2-Fluorocyclopropaneamine
  • 2-fluoro-CyClopropanamine
  • 2-fluorocyclopropan-1-amine
